Wiki Ubuntu-it

Indice
Partecipa
FAQ
Wiki Blog
------------------
Ubuntu-it.org
Forum
Chiedi
Chat
Cerca
Planet
  • Pagina non alterabile
  • Informazioni
  • Allegati
  • Differenze per "Hardware/Video/SisXgiVolari"
Differenze tra le versioni 20 e 62 (in 42 versioni)
Versione 20 del 04/03/2008 19.14.00
Dimensione: 3525
Commento:
Versione 62 del 19/07/2015 13.05.13
Dimensione: 4756
Autore: a7n8x
Commento:
Le cancellazioni sono segnalate in questo modo. Le aggiunte sono segnalate in questo modo.
Linea 1: Linea 1:
## page was renamed from DriverPerSiS
||<tablestyle="float:right; font-size: 0.9em; width:35%; background:#F1F1ED; margin: 0 0 1em 1em;" style="padding:0.5em;">'''Indice'''[[BR]][[TableOfContents]]||
## page was renamed from Hardware/Video/SiS
#format wiki
#language it
<<BR>>
<<Indice(depth=1)>>
<<Informazioni(forum="http://forum.ubuntu-it.org/viewtopic.php?t=164012"; rilasci="13.04 12.10 12.04")>>
Linea 5: Linea 10:
Questa guida descrive come installare driver per schede grafiche della '''Silicon Integrated Systems'''. Si descrive anche la procedura per installare il programma di gestione '''sisctrl'''. Si ringrazia ''Thomas Winischhofer'' che, per passione e con competenza, implementa e aggiorna questi drivers e crea programmi come, '''sisctrl''', per gestirle.
Linea 7: Linea 11:
= Individuare l'hardware = Il driver '''sis''' supporta tutte le schede '''SiS''' e '''XGI Volari''' e fornisce accelerazione 3D solo alle schede che dispongono di chipset della serie 300 (300, 540, 630, 730).
Linea 9: Linea 13:
Con il comando:
{{{
lspci|grep VGA
Se si dispone di una scheda grafica '''SiS 771 Mirage''' o '''SiS 671 Mirage''' seguire la [[/Sis771-671|relativa pagina]].

= Identificare la scheda video =

 * Aprire una finestra di terminale e digitare il seguente comando: {{{
lspci | grep VGA
Linea 13: Linea 20:
vengono descritti i dispositivi PCI. Nel nostro caso, per la scheda grafica, dovremmo avere un output del genere:
{{{
Linea 16: Linea 21:
01:00.0 VGA compatible controller: Silicon Integrated Systems [SiS] 661/741/760/761 PCI/AGP VGA Display Adapter}}}  * Il risultato del precedente comando sarà simile al seguente: {{{
01:00.0 VGA compatible controller: Silicon Integrated Systems [SiS] 661/741/760/761 PCI/AGP VGA Display Adapter
}}}

= Installazione =

Il driver è già presente di default in '''Ubuntu''' ed è automaticamente attivato dal server grafico X se è stata rilevata una scheda supportata.

Per verificare che il driver sia attualmente utilizzato dal sistema è sufficiente digitare il seguente comando in una finestra di terminale: {{{
lsmod | grep sis
}}}

Se non si ottiene alcun output, significa che il driver non è attivo, per attivarlo:

 * Creare con un [[Ufficio/EditorDiTesto|editor di testo]] e con i [[AmministrazioneSistema/Sudo|privilegi di amministrazione]] il file `/etc/X11/xorg.conf` ed incollare al suo interno le righe: {{{
Section "Device"
 Identifier "Configured Video Device"
 Driver "sis"
EndSection }}}

 * Salvare le modifiche al file e riavviare il sistema.

Se si desidera disabilitare l'accelerazione grafica, inserire nella Section"Device" la riga: {{{
Option "NoAccel" "True" }}}
Linea 19: Linea 47:
||<tablestyle="text-align: justify; width:100%; " style="border:none;" 5%><<Immagine(Icone/Piccole/note.png,,center)>> ||<style="padding:0.5em; border:none;">''[[AmbienteGrafico/CompositeManager/CompizFusion|Compiz Fusion]] non è supportato dal driver'' '''sis'''. ||
Linea 20: Linea 49:
= Scaricare e installare driver e programma di gestione = = Problemi e soluzioni =
Linea 22: Linea 51:
Dopo aver individuato il modello della scheda grafica: == Sfarfallio dell'immagine o linee verticali ==
Linea 24: Linea 53:
 * scaricare il driver da: [http://www.winischhofer.eu/linuxsispart4.shtml#download winischhofer.eu] In alcuni sistemi si possono verificare sfarfallii dell'immagine o linee verticali colorate specialmente quando vengono collegati due schermi. Le possibili soluzioni al problema sono ridurre la profondità di colore a 16 bit oppure cambiare la frequenza di aggiornamento dello schermo.
Linea 26: Linea 55:
 * scaricare il programma di gestione [http://www.winischhofer.net/sis/debian/unstable/sisctrl_0.0.20051202-1_i386.deb sisctrl] == Errore nei colori ==
Linea 28: Linea 57:
Se si verificano errori nella riproduzione dei colori, può essere di aiuto la seguente opzione del driver: {{{
Option "useROMData " "False" }}}
Linea 29: Linea 60:
C'è la possibilità di inserire il repository: {{{
deb http://www.winischhofer.net/sis/debian/unstable ./
== Formato del video non modificabile ==

Se non è possibile modificare le dimensioni della finestra di riproduzione video, le seguenti opzioni potrebbero aiutare: {{{
Option "EnableSiSCtrl" "yes"
Option "XvDefaultAdaptor" "Overlay" }}}

== Risoluzioni più elevate con chip 6326 ==

Per utilizzare risoluzioni più elevate a seguito della modalità di chip 6326 deve essere impostato in `xorg.conf`: {{{
Modes "SIS1600x1200-60" "SIS1280x1024-75" }}}

Se necessario, la profondità del colore deve essere ridotta a 16 bit.

== Console virtuale non visualizzata correttamente ==

Se la console presenta degli sfarfallii, impostare nei parametri di boot l'opzione : {{{
VGA=0 }}}

Su alcuni sistemi questa soluzione non funziona, per superare il problema digitare nella console: {{{
sudo su
echo blacklist vga16fb > /etc/modprobe.d/blacklist-vga16fb.conf
update-initramfs -u }}}

= Bassa risoluzione con i chip 661/741/760 =

Se si utilizzano i driver sis e la risoluzione dello risulta inferiore a 1024x768, sostituire nel file `xorg.conf` la voce "sis" con "vesa" e riavviare.

= SiSCtrl =

'''SiSCtrl''' è un'interfaccia per cambiare alcuni parametri del driver su schede della serie 300, 315, 330 ,340 e XGI Volari . Non si esclude che possa funzionare su altre schede non menzionate.

 * Scaricare il pacchetto ''sisctrl'': {{{
wget http://vejeta.sdf-eu.org/sis/sisctrl_0.0.20051202-1_i386.deb
Linea 32: Linea 94:
 * Installarlo: {{{
sudo dpkg -i sisctrl_0.0.20051202-1_i386.deb
}}}
 * Per attivare l'interfaccia grafica modificare con un editor di testo e con i [[AmministrazioneSistema/Sudo|privilegi di amministrazione ]] il file `/etc/X11/xorg.conf` inserendo l'opzione {{{
Option “EnableSiSCtrl” “on”
}}} nella sezione ''"Device"''.
 * Il risulato deve essere simile al seguente {{{
Section “Device”
  Identifier “Nome scheda grafica”
  Driver “sis”
  Option “EnableSiSCtrl” “on”
  ...
EndSection
}}}
 * Salvare il file e riavviare il sistema.
Linea 33: Linea 110:
e di autenticare le chiavi con il comando:
{{{
gpg --keyserver hkp://wwwkeys.eu.pgp.net --recv-keys 092dc947
gpg --armor --export 092dc947 | sudo apt-key add -
}}}
e poi procedere con '''Synaptyc'''. Questa alternativa non è stata testata.


Fatto ciò decomprimere il driver (che sarà il file {{{sis_drv.so}}}) e copiarlo nella cartella {{{/usr/lib/xorg/modules/drivers/}}}.

Siccome esiste già un driver con quel nome sarà meglio fare una copia del file esistente, in caso di problemi, e poi sostituirlo con il nuovo.

Decomprimere il programma e installare anche quello (tasto destro mouse sul file '''''Kubuntu Package Menu -> Installa''''').

Ora in '''''Menu K (o Applicazioni) -> Accessori''''' dovrebbe esserci la voce '''SiSCtrl'''.

= Modifica di xorg.conf =

Dopo aver fatto tutto ciò, per rendere funzionante il tutto, bisogna modificare il file {{{/etc/X11/xorg.conf}}} (previa solita copia di sicurezza)

Aprire {{{xorg.conf}}} con un editor di testo e con i [:AmministrazioneSistema/Sudo:privilegi di amministrazione] e controllare che nella ''Section'' ''"Device"'' alla voce ''Driver'' ci sia '''"sis"''' ed inserire, sempre nella stessa posizione '''Option "EnableSiSCtrl" "yes"''' come nel seguente esempio:

{{{
Section "Device"
        Identifier "Scheda video SiS"
        Driver "sis"
        BusID "PCI:1:0:0"
        Option "EnableSiSCtrl" "yes"
EndSection
}}}

Riavviare ora il server X con la combinazione di tasti '''''Ctrl+Alt+Backspace'''''.
||<tablestyle="text-align: justify; width:100%; " style="border:none;" 5%>[[Immagine(Icone/Piccole/note.png,,center)]] ||<style="padding:0.5em; border:none;">'''Per ogni aggiornamento del kernel bisognerà ricopiare il file {{{sis_drv.so}}} nella sua posizione; per ogni aggiornamento di {{{xorg.conf}}} e dei pacchetti ''gcc'' bisognerà scaricare il nuovo file {{{sis_drv.so}}} e posizionarlo come descritto sopra.''' ||


= Ulteriori risorse =

 * Il link di riferimento del sito di [http://www.winischhofer.eu/linuxsispart4.shtml#download Thomas Winischhofer]
L'applicazione sarà disponibile in '''''Applicazioni → Accessori → SiSCtrl'''''.


Problemi in questa pagina? Segnalali in questa discussione

Introduzione

Il driver sis supporta tutte le schede SiS e XGI Volari e fornisce accelerazione 3D solo alle schede che dispongono di chipset della serie 300 (300, 540, 630, 730).

Se si dispone di una scheda grafica SiS 771 Mirage o SiS 671 Mirage seguire la relativa pagina.

Identificare la scheda video

  • Aprire una finestra di terminale e digitare il seguente comando:

    lspci | grep VGA
  • Il risultato del precedente comando sarà simile al seguente:

    01:00.0 VGA compatible controller: Silicon Integrated Systems [SiS] 661/741/760/761 PCI/AGP VGA Display Adapter

Installazione

Il driver è già presente di default in Ubuntu ed è automaticamente attivato dal server grafico X se è stata rilevata una scheda supportata.

Per verificare che il driver sia attualmente utilizzato dal sistema è sufficiente digitare il seguente comando in una finestra di terminale:

lsmod | grep sis

Se non si ottiene alcun output, significa che il driver non è attivo, per attivarlo:

  • Creare con un editor di testo e con i privilegi di amministrazione il file /etc/X11/xorg.conf ed incollare al suo interno le righe:

    Section "Device"
            Identifier      "Configured Video Device"
            Driver          "sis"
    EndSection 
  • Salvare le modifiche al file e riavviare il sistema.

Se si desidera disabilitare l'accelerazione grafica, inserire nella Section"Device" la riga:

Option          "NoAccel" "True" 

Compiz Fusion non è supportato dal driver sis.

Problemi e soluzioni

Sfarfallio dell'immagine o linee verticali

In alcuni sistemi si possono verificare sfarfallii dell'immagine o linee verticali colorate specialmente quando vengono collegati due schermi. Le possibili soluzioni al problema sono ridurre la profondità di colore a 16 bit oppure cambiare la frequenza di aggiornamento dello schermo.

Errore nei colori

Se si verificano errori nella riproduzione dei colori, può essere di aiuto la seguente opzione del driver:

Option          "useROMData " "False" 

Formato del video non modificabile

Se non è possibile modificare le dimensioni della finestra di riproduzione video, le seguenti opzioni potrebbero aiutare:

Option          "EnableSiSCtrl" "yes"
Option          "XvDefaultAdaptor" "Overlay" 

Risoluzioni più elevate con chip 6326

Per utilizzare risoluzioni più elevate a seguito della modalità di chip 6326 deve essere impostato in xorg.conf:

Modes           "SIS1600x1200-60" "SIS1280x1024-75" 

Se necessario, la profondità del colore deve essere ridotta a 16 bit.

Console virtuale non visualizzata correttamente

Se la console presenta degli sfarfallii, impostare nei parametri di boot l'opzione :

VGA=0 

Su alcuni sistemi questa soluzione non funziona, per superare il problema digitare nella console:

sudo su
echo blacklist vga16fb > /etc/modprobe.d/blacklist-vga16fb.conf
update-initramfs -u 

Bassa risoluzione con i chip 661/741/760

Se si utilizzano i driver sis e la risoluzione dello risulta inferiore a 1024x768, sostituire nel file xorg.conf la voce "sis" con "vesa" e riavviare.

SiSCtrl

SiSCtrl è un'interfaccia per cambiare alcuni parametri del driver su schede della serie 300, 315, 330 ,340 e XGI Volari . Non si esclude che possa funzionare su altre schede non menzionate.

  • Scaricare il pacchetto sisctrl:

    wget http://vejeta.sdf-eu.org/sis/sisctrl_0.0.20051202-1_i386.deb
  • Installarlo:

    sudo dpkg -i sisctrl_0.0.20051202-1_i386.deb
  • Per attivare l'interfaccia grafica modificare con un editor di testo e con i privilegi di amministrazione il file /etc/X11/xorg.conf inserendo l'opzione

    Option “EnableSiSCtrl” “on”

    nella sezione "Device".

  • Il risulato deve essere simile al seguente

    Section “Device”
      Identifier “Nome scheda grafica”
      Driver “sis”
      Option “EnableSiSCtrl” “on”
      ...
    EndSection
  • Salvare il file e riavviare il sistema.

L'applicazione sarà disponibile in Applicazioni → Accessori → SiSCtrl.


CategoryHardware